From Youtube This video shows the incredible skills of the pilots. Even after an unexpected wind gust after touchdown they managed to re-align with the runway. Incredible job by the pilots!!
Click here to cancel reply.
featured Woman car Dog try not to laugh world Hilarious man animals Trailer funny Police cat Official Trailer amazing driver footage crazy Fails camera